Artificial Intelligence Learning Facilitators: Creating Smart Education Systems delves into the various AI-based techniques, such as machine learning and natural language processing, that can help in automating management tasks such as lecture preparation, students’ performance evaluation, and predictive performance assessment. It highlights the importance of AI in handling the increasing learning complexities. The book explores the use of AI-based virtual assistants and chatbots in enhancing teaching services for students and instructors. It also discusses the potential of AI in creating personalized and targeted learning experiences.

Dr. Fadi Al-Turjman received his Ph.D. in computer science from Queen’s University, Canada, in 2011. He is a professor and the associate dean for research and the founding director of the International Research Center for AI and IoT at Near East University, Nicosia, Cyprus. Prof. Al-Turjman is the head of the Artificial Intelligence Engineering Department, and a leading authority in the areas of smart/intelligent IoT systems, wireless, and mobile networks’ architectures, protocols, deployments, and performance evaluation in Artificial Intelligence of Things (AIoT).
